Namaste Trump

| @indiablooms | Feb 24, 2020, at 09:45 am

US President Donald Trump is visiting India for two days. He will arrive in India on Monday and participate in several events across Ahmedabad, Agra and New Delhi.

Prime Minister Narendra Modi wished Trump and said India is 'awaiting' his arrival.
